How they compare
Peru currently reports 7.71 million people against 7.26 million people in Sierra Leone, a difference of 456,660 people.
That makes Peru's figure about 1.1 times Sierra Leone's.
Across all 13 years both countries report, Peru has been ahead every year.
Peru ranks 48th and Sierra Leone ranks 49th of 189 countries.
Peru has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Peru | Sierra Leone |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 11.68 million people | 5.86 million people | 5.82 million people | Peru |
| 2010s | 8.69 million people | 6.82 million people | 1.88 million people | Peru |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
